Description
We are looking for a highly technical Capacity Planning Lead to own the demand-and-supply modeling that drives our hiring plans, headcount strategy, and budgetary decisions with leadership.
You will architect the Capacity Engine, build and maintain a comprehensive capacity model, and mathematically map volume mix, omnichannel routing, offshore capture rates, customer escalations, and more.
You will also model Agent Productivity, transform raw agent-level workforce data into actionable intelligence, compute ticket lifecycle metrics, validate handle time distributions, and build logic to detect outlier behaviors.
Additionally, you will own the Financial Translation, bridge the gap between Operations and Finance, and translate Erlang C FTE requirements into a fully loaded staffing plan.
You will drive BPO Capacity Locks, generate and enforce the 30-60-90 day headcount lock plans for our offshore vendor partners, and hold them accountable to forecasted hiring and shrinkage targets.
You will own the Staffing Plan, compute, align, and project operational rates down to the customer's issue-type level and market segment, and apply seasonality adjustments and project demand across monthly, quarterly, and multi-year horizons.
If you have a deep understanding of capacity planning fundamentals, cross-functional influence, data-backed storytelling, and AI-augmented execution, you'd be a great fit for this role.
